Marie Stiborová (2 February 1950 – 13 February 2020) was a Czech university lecturer, politician, and a member of the Czech National Council and Chamber of Deputies. She was also the candidate for the Communist Party (KSČM) in the 1993 presidential election. She later became the leader of the reformist wing within KSČM and established the Left Bloc.
